图书馆管理系统设计与开发——SSH框架实现

需积分: 5 0 下载量 150 浏览量 更新于2024-06-21 收藏 965KB DOC 举报
"图书馆管理系统的设计与开发使用了SSH框架,涵盖了需求分析、系统设计、实现与测试等阶段。系统采用JSP作为开发语言,SQL数据库进行数据存储,通过ER图和关系模型进行了数据库设计。" 这篇毕业论文详细阐述了一个基于JSP(JavaServer Pages)的图书馆管理系统的设计与开发过程。该系统旨在提供一个高效、便捷的图书管理平台,包括图书类别管理、图书管理、读者管理以及图书借阅等功能模块。在系统分析部分,作者深入探讨了图书馆管理系统的实际需求,进行了业务流程分析,明确了系统管理员、读者等相关角色的操作流程。 在数据流程分析环节,论文详细介绍了图书类别管理、图书管理、读者管理、图书借阅及修改密码等关键模块的数据流动和处理过程。同时,通过数据字典,对系统涉及的数据项和数据流进行了详尽描述,帮助理解系统内部信息的流转机制。 在系统设计阶段,作者提出了系统的体系结构,包括各个子模块的功能,以及数据库的概念设计、逻辑设计和选型。数据库设计使用了ER图(实体-关系模型)进行概念设计,转换为关系模型,并且详细规划了数据库表结构和表间关系。此外,还讨论了系统开发工具的选择,如JSP用于前端展示和后端逻辑处理,SQL数据库用于数据存储,以及所采用的设计模式。 系统实现部分,作者逐步展示了登录模块、图书类别管理、图书管理、读者管理和图书借阅管理的实现细节,包括相关代码示例。这有助于读者理解系统功能的具体实现方式。 在系统测试环节,论文描述了测试的目的、方法和结果,确保系统功能的正确性和稳定性。最后,作者进行了总结,强调了此项目在解决图书馆管理问题上的实用性和有效性,同时也表达了对指导老师和参考文献的感谢。 这篇毕业论文全面展示了基于SSH框架的图书馆管理系统的开发流程,提供了从需求分析到系统测试的完整案例,对于学习和理解Web应用开发,尤其是图书馆管理系统的构建,具有很高的参考价值。